4.0 out of 5 stars Somehow some birds have flown 2 Aug 2005
By Bert on the tracks - Published on Amazon.com
Format:Hardcover
I am a little bit disappointed with this book. It is beautifully edited and beautifully printed as any book edited by twin palms is, let there be no doubt. One would only buy these books because they are so beautifully edited.

About half of the photographs really work. About the other half I have this feeling that these birds have flown. I have this feeling - but I could be wrong - that some of the photographs were sought to fill enough pages as to come to a complete body of work. I highly value the work by Graciela Iturbide : half of the pictures would have made a book twice as thin but really more than three times better. Anyway, for anyone who loves real photography I recommend this book.
